
IDEG Opposes Presidential Nomination of DCE Candidates in Ghana
The Institute for Democratic Governance (IDEG) has voiced its opposition to the presidential nomination of District Chief Executive (DCE) candidates for election. This stance was outlined in a position paper submitted as part of Ghana's constitutional review process.

The Institute for Democratic Governance (IDEG) has said it does not support the proposal for the President to nominate five persons from whom three would contest District Chief Executives (DCEs) elections as contained in the government's position paper on the Constitutional Review Committee's report.
